Ambassador Kullane Delivers Speech at the Launch of Progress Report on Global Development Initiative (GDI)

Beijing, China (SONNA) – The Center for International Knowledge on Development (CIKD) hosted the highly anticipated Launch of the Progress Report on the Implementation of the Global Development Initiative (GDI). The event, held at the World Harmony House, brought together Chinese government officials, international stakeholders, think tanks, and distinguished guests to discuss the progress made in advancing sustainable development through the GDI.

The Somali Ambassador to China, H.E. Mr. Awale Ali Kullane, delivered a compelling speech on the theme “Collaboration and Commitment: Advancing Sustainable Development through the Global Development Initiative.” In his address, Ambassador Kullane expressed his gratitude to CIKD for organizing this important event and commended China and its international partners for their unwavering efforts in promoting sustainable development.

The Progress Report, produced by CIKD in collaboration with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and other line ministries, served as the centerpiece of the event. This comprehensive report meticulously examined the mechanisms, pathways, and substantial measures undertaken in implementing the GDI. It provided valuable insights into the progress achieved so far and offered key policy recommendations for further advancing the Initiative and contributing to the Sustainable Development Goals.

Ambassador Kullane emphasized the commitment of Somalia to global development efforts and highlighted the importance of international cooperation in achieving the Sustainable Development Goals. He stated, “The GDI aligns perfectly with our own national development agenda, and we are eager to actively contribute to its implementation.” The Ambassador also emphasized the significance of collaboration, innovation, and inclusiveness in addressing the challenges faced by Somalia and the global community.

The launch event witnessed speeches and discussions from Chinese government officials, international stakeholders, and think tanks. Around 150 representatives from UN agencies, international organizations, embassies, think tanks, media, and Chinese government departments attended the event, reflecting the broad international interest and commitment towards the GDI.

Dr. Zhao Changwen, President of CIKD, expressed his appreciation for the dedication and hard work of his team in organizing the event and producing the Progress Report. He reiterated CIKD’s commitment to promoting international knowledge on development and supporting the implementation of the GDI.

The Launch of the Progress Report on the Implementation of the Global Development Initiative marked a significant milestone in the global effort towards sustainable development. By fostering collaboration, innovation, and a shared vision, the international community aims to overcome the challenges faced and build a brighter future for all.
